Have you asked your local place what they can order in for you? My village shop keeps big bags of dog food, but when I asked they said they could order big bags of cat food for me on request - so then I requested poultry feed and they get that for me too! They have said that if their supplier has it they'll order in for me - I haven't asked for oyster grit yet I have to admit  :tongue2: As an ignorant newbie I got my original bucket from FsoFancy last year, 5kg for £4.99 plus delivery, my local farmers' store sells 25kg for £7 ! it's a 50 mile round trip though so I have to be down there anyway to make it worthwhile - so hurrah for my fab village whop.
